The same audit found that linked row-major writes must not be normalized as independent parallel arrays.
Corpus `lookup-array-2d` bases and strides assign every such ITINIT write unambiguously to six tables (43
populated columns), while SKINIT and EBINIT expose 17 and 83 linked columns respectively. Generated records
now keep these under `record_fields[base/stride/column]`; `fields` contains only genuine parallel arrays.
